package webauthn
import (
"errors"
"fmt"
"testing"
"time"
"github.com/lestrrat-go/jwx/v3/jwt"
"github.com/stretchr/testify/assert"
"github.com/stretchr/testify/require"
"github.com/pocket-id/pocket-id/backend/internal/common"
"github.com/pocket-id/pocket-id/backend/internal/model"
datatype "github.com/pocket-id/pocket-id/backend/internal/model/types"
"github.com/pocket-id/pocket-id/backend/internal/utils"
testutils "github.com/pocket-id/pocket-id/backend/internal/utils/testing"
)
// fakeSigner is an in-memory TokenService that mints opaque tokens carrying a subject,
// an issued-at time and an optional authentication method, without any real signing
type fakeSigner struct {
tokens map[string]jwt.Token
counter int
}
func newFakeSigner() *fakeSigner {
return &fakeSigner{tokens: map[string]jwt.Token{}}
}
func (s *fakeSigner) GenerateAccessToken(user model.User, authenticationMethod string) (string, error) {
builder := jwt.NewBuilder().
Subject(user.ID).
IssuedAt(time.Now())
if authenticationMethod != "" {
builder = builder.Claim(common.AuthenticationMethodsClaim, []string{authenticationMethod})
}
token, err := builder.Build()
if err != nil {
return "", err
}
s.counter++
raw := fmt.Sprintf("fake-access-token-%d", s.counter)
s.tokens[raw] = token
return raw, nil
}
func (s *fakeSigner) VerifyAccessToken(tokenString string) (jwt.Token, error) {
token, ok := s.tokens[tokenString]
if !ok {
return nil, errors.New("invalid token")
}
return token, nil
}
func (s *fakeSigner) GetAuthenticationMethod(token jwt.Token) (string, error) {
if !token.Has(common.AuthenticationMethodsClaim) {
return "", nil
}
var methods []string
if err := token.Get(common.AuthenticationMethodsClaim, &methods); err != nil {
return "", err
}
if len(methods) == 0 {
return "", nil
}
return methods[0], nil
}
func TestCreateReauthenticationTokenWithAccessToken(t *testing.T) {
setupService := func(t *testing.T) (*Service, *fakeSigner, model.User) {
t.Helper()
db := testutils.NewDatabaseForTest(t)
user := model.User{
Base: model.Base{ID: "reauth-user"},
Username: "reauth-user",
}
require.NoError(t, db.Create(&user).Error)
signer := newFakeSigner()
return &Service{db: db, signer: signer}, signer, user
}
t.Run("accepts a fresh access token from WebAuthn login", func(t *testing.T) {
service, signer, user := setupService(t)
accessToken, err := signer.GenerateAccessToken(user, authenticationMethodPhishingResistant)
require.NoError(t, err)
reauthenticationToken, err := service.CreateReauthenticationTokenWithAccessToken(t.Context(), accessToken)
require.NoError(t, err)
assert.NotEmpty(t, reauthenticationToken)
})
t.Run("rejects a fresh access token from one-time access login", func(t *testing.T) {
service, signer, user := setupService(t)
accessToken, err := signer.GenerateAccessToken(user, "otp")
require.NoError(t, err)
reauthenticationToken, err := service.CreateReauthenticationTokenWithAccessToken(t.Context(), accessToken)
assert.Empty(t, reauthenticationToken)
require.Error(t, err)
assert.ErrorAs(t, err, new(*common.ReauthenticationRequiredError))
})
t.Run("rejects a fresh access token without an authentication method", func(t *testing.T) {
service, signer, user := setupService(t)
accessToken, err := signer.GenerateAccessToken(user, "")
require.NoError(t, err)
reauthenticationToken, err := service.CreateReauthenticationTokenWithAccessToken(t.Context(), accessToken)
assert.Empty(t, reauthenticationToken)
require.Error(t, err)
assert.ErrorAs(t, err, new(*common.ReauthenticationRequiredError))
})
}
func TestConsumeReauthenticationTokenReturnsTokenCreationTime(t *testing.T) {
db := testutils.NewDatabaseForTest(t)
service := &Service{db: db}
const (
userID = "reauth-user"
token = "reauthentication-token"
)
require.NoError(t, db.Create(&model.User{
Base: model.Base{ID: userID},
}).Error)
require.NoError(t, db.Create(&ReauthenticationToken{
Token: utils.CreateSha256Hash(token),
ExpiresAt: datatype.DateTime(time.Now().Add(time.Minute)),
UserID: userID,
}).Error)
var storedToken ReauthenticationToken
require.NoError(t, db.First(&storedToken, "user_id = ?", userID).Error)
tx := db.Begin()
reauthenticatedAt, err := service.ConsumeReauthenticationToken(t.Context(), tx, token, userID)
require.NoError(t, err)
require.NoError(t, tx.Commit().Error)
require.Equal(t, storedToken.CreatedAt.UTC(), reauthenticatedAt)
}
